The University was established as the Central University of Jammu and Kashmir. It was established along with 15 other Central Universities by an Act of Parliament in 2009. The University has been granted 503+ acres of land during its establishment by the state government. CUK has 21 schools and 21 constituent teaching departments. These establishments offer 40+ PG, UG, Diploma, Research, and Vocational programmes.

The mode of University of Jammu course admissions is online. Jammu University BTech admission to various courses is based on entrance exam scores, interview rounds, and merit. The accepted entrance exams are JKCET, JEE Main, CUET, and others. Candidates applying through CUET must first visit the official website and register for the CUET exam. Then, appear for the CUET exam. In the next step, students must apply on the Jammu University official website with valid scores. In the next step, students must take part in the interview and various other rounds involved in the Jammu University admission.

The Emeritus Fellowship, the Dr. S. Radhakrishnan Postdoctoral Fellowship of Humanities and Social Sciences, the Post-Doctoral Fellowship for Women, the Post-Doctoral Fellowship for SC/ST applicants, and other scholarships and fellowships are among those that the Central University of Jammu awards to students.
Swami Vivekananda Scholarship for Unmarried Girl Child Research in Social Science, Rajiv Gandhi Fellowship for individuals with disabilities, Rajiv Gandhi National Fellowship for candidates from SC/ST National Fellowship for OBC applicants, Maulana Azad National Fellowship for Minority Students Post-Graduation Scholarship for Professional Courses for SC/ST Candidates, Indira Gandhi PG Scholarship for a single girl child, and PG Scholarship for University rank holders Ishan Uday, Ms. Agatha Harrison Memorial Fellowship, and the Special Scholarship Program for the North Easters Region.
But there's no mention of a scholarship worth 100% that's exclusive to Central University.
